云服務(wù)器的負載均衡,提高應用可用性
發(fā)布日期:
2024-06-13 17:39:31
本文鏈接
http://www.etbxb.com//help/1499.html
本文關(guān)鍵詞
一鍵直達:華為云服務(wù)器,阿里云服務(wù)器
在網(wǎng)絡(luò)應用規(guī)模不斷擴大的今天,單臺服務(wù)器已經(jīng)很難承擔所有的用戶請求。云服務(wù)器的負載均衡技術(shù)通過在多個服務(wù)器間智能分配流量,不僅提升了應用的處理能力,也增強了系統(tǒng)的穩(wěn)定性和可靠性。
負載均衡的定義與重要性
負載均衡概念:負載均衡是一種網(wǎng)絡(luò)流量管理技術(shù),通過將用戶請求分散到多個服務(wù)器,避免任何單點的過載,從而提高應用的響應速度和可用性。
提高可用性:在負載均衡架構(gòu)中,即使某臺服務(wù)器發(fā)生故障,其他服務(wù)器仍可繼續(xù)提供服務(wù),從而實現(xiàn)零或最小化的服務(wù)中斷。
優(yōu)化性能:合理分配請求到服務(wù)器,避免某些服務(wù)器過載而影響性能,確保所有服務(wù)器的資源得到充分利用。
負載均衡的類型
1. 硬件負載均衡:使用專用的硬件設(shè)備如負載均衡器來實現(xiàn)流量的分配,通常具有高性能但成本較高。
2. 軟件負載均衡:利用開源軟件如Nginx或HAProxy,成本較低且靈活,但可能需要更多的維護工作。
3. 云負載均衡服務(wù):云服務(wù)商提供的負載均衡解決方案,如AWS ELB、Google Cloud Load Balancing等,易于集成且可擴展。
實現(xiàn)負載均衡的策略
1. 輪詢調(diào)度:將請求按順序平均分配到每臺服務(wù)器,適合服務(wù)器性能相近的情況。
2. 最少連接調(diào)度:將請求分配給當前活躍連接數(shù)最少的服務(wù)器,適合處理大量長連接的應用。
3. 基于地理位置的調(diào)度:根據(jù)用戶的地理位置,將請求路由到最近的服務(wù)器,減少延遲。
云環(huán)境中的負載均衡配置
1. 自動擴展:結(jié)合負載均衡設(shè)置自動擴展策略,根據(jù)流量變化自動增減云服務(wù)器實例。
2. 健康檢查:配置負載均衡器進行定期健康檢查,確保請求只被轉(zhuǎn)發(fā)到健康的服務(wù)器。
3. SSL終端:利用負載均衡器進行SSL/TLS加密和解密,減輕后端服務(wù)器的計算負擔。
負載均衡的最佳實踐
1. 冗余設(shè)計:在多個區(qū)域部署負載均衡器,確保主負載均衡器故障時可以快速切換。
2. 安全配置:集成WAF和DDoS防護措施,提高應用的安全性。
3. 性能監(jiān)控:利用云監(jiān)控工具持續(xù)跟蹤負載均衡器和后端服務(wù)器的性能指標。
面臨的挑戰(zhàn)與解決方案
1. 配置復雜性:隨著服務(wù)規(guī)模的擴大,負載均衡的配置變得復雜。采用基礎(chǔ)設(shè)施即代碼(IaC)工具如Terraform或Ansible自動化配置。
2. 成本管理:監(jiān)控和優(yōu)化資源使用,選擇按需付費或預留實例等計費模式以控制成本。
3. 流量預測:利用歷史數(shù)據(jù)分析和機器學習模型預測流量模式,合理規(guī)劃資源。
負載均衡是云服務(wù)器不可或缺的一部分,它為應用提供了水平擴展的能力,確保了高可用性和卓越的性能。通過精心設(shè)計和持續(xù)優(yōu)化負載均衡策略,企業(yè)可以在云中構(gòu)建一個強大、靈活且高效的服務(wù)架構(gòu)。
極云科技是國內(nèi)知名的云計算及IDC基礎(chǔ)服務(wù)提供商,四川省高新技術(shù)企業(yè),擁有中華??共和國?業(yè)和信息化部頒發(fā)的跨地區(qū)增值電信業(yè)務(wù)(ISP)許可證、華為云經(jīng)銷商資質(zhì)并取得多項軟著證書。業(yè)務(wù)涵蓋公有云、IDC租用托管、等保安全、私有云建設(shè)等企業(yè)級互聯(lián)網(wǎng)基礎(chǔ)服務(wù)。咨詢電話:400-028-0032。官網(wǎng)地址:http://www.etbxb.com。
優(yōu)選機房